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Color can be tricky when it comes to print versus electronics. Print uses ink to produce color, whereas electronics use light. Print uses a subtractive color model based on cyan, magenta, yellow, and black. Electronics use an additive color model based on red, green, and blue. Due to these differences, print renders color differently in comparison to electronics. Vibrancy and color consistency between print and electronics will invariably differentiate. The degree of differentiation can range from a subtle shade to a different color altogether. There is no foolproof way to reconcile the color conundrum between print and electronics. The best solution to meeting color expectations between the two modes are hard copy color charts. The charts will not change the differences between the two modes. What the charts will do is allow a self-publisher to see how a color renders in print versus electronic sources. By knowing this, self-publishers can modify color choices to colors that will render acceptably well within both modes.

Book excerpt: When is CMYK an appropriate color mode choice? When your main objective is to create for print publishing. Examples include the following: business cards, brochures, and paperback or hardcover books, to name a few.Most modern design software allows working in CMYK mode or incorporates a CMYK preview mode. However, even when working in CMYK mode, you are viewing an approximation of how color will appear on a printed end product. Light is producing the approximation, not ink. Generally, the actual colors on the printed product will vary in darkness and dullness. Thus, the need for hard copy color charts.CMYK Hard Copy Color Charts does not include shades. This book focuses on the most vivid and clear colors possible within the CMYK color range. Albeit, the gray scale chart utilizes black. The gray scale chart includes scaled values for flat black, cool black, warm black, and rich black.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: As an illustrator, there are times I prefer using the HSL color model versus either RGB or CMYK when creating my illustrations. For artwork featured in books that sell equally well in electronic and print formats, RGB is a good choice. However, CMYK generally is better for artwork featured in books that sell primarily in print format. For creations viewed mainly on electronic sources, HSL is without question my preferred choice.Developed in 1978, HSL was George Joblove's answer to creating a color model more in line with how humans perceive color versus how electronic sources create color. As humans, we tend to think of the three primary colors-red, blue, and yellow-as the basis for all other colors. For example, combining blue and yellow for green; yellow and red for orange; red and blue for purple-the secondary colors. Additionally, when it comes to the lightness or intensity of color, we tend to think in terms of gray scale manipulation versus color combinations.Besides artwork to be viewed mainly on electronic sources, when do I prefer HSL over RGB or CMYK? When creating realism, establishing moods, retro pieces, and illustrations for children with color sensitivity, to name a few. Why? Ease of use for adjusting saturation and lightness--components utilized when creating these types of artwork. Why saturation and lightness are instrumental for these examples is an entirely different topic. The point is to show HSL may be better suited to particular compositions. RGB, CMYK, and HSL all have a place in my creative arsenal.Most printers require CMYK press-ready files when processing digital artwork. So, why create using HSL if the files sent are CMYK press-ready? As mentioned above, ease of use during the creation process. Secondly, even though the files are processed using CMYK, color renders differently on the end product when using a color mode other than CMYK during the creation phase. Using HSL intentionally manipulates how colors appear on the printed end product.
